    VIKTOR DALLAKYAN: ARMENIAN EX-PRESIDENT TO ANNOUNCE HIS NOMINATION IN UPCOMING ELECTION

    ArmInfo
    2007-10-22 22:56:00

    "I see no sense in hindering the rally headed by the first president
    of Armenia, Levon Ter-Petrosyan, that will take place on October
    26," Viktor Dallakyan, an independent Armenian MP, told ArmInfo
    correspondent.

    According to him, as a rule, if one tries to hinder a rally, this
    causes the opposite process. The attempt of the political forces to
    artificially hinder the rally allowed by the Yerevan City Hall may
    have negative consequences, the MP noted. He added that a tradition
    should be formed in the country, according to which the constitutional
    laws on holding of rallies and processions should work.

    "I don't think that any incidents may take place during the rally,
    which will disturb the security of our country," V.Dallakyan said. He
    thinks that Levon Ter-Petrosyan's team, which has a great political
    experience, may use the fact of the rally's suppression for its
    own interests. V. Dallakyan also emphasized that after his speech
    during the festive reception in Marriott-Armenia Hotel and his
    recent meetings with different political forces, during the rally
    L Ter-Petrosyan will declare about his nomination in the coming
    presidential election. Otherwise, his steps will not fit within the
    frames of political actions.

    To recall, the rally of opposition forces under the chairmanship of
    the first Armenian president Levon Ter Petrosyan, "Republic" Party
    Leader Aram Sarksyan and Leader of "People's Party" Stepan Demirchyan
    will take place on October 26. On the same day, the Republican Party
    of Armenia organizes a concert "Gold autumn".
